Why Eau Claire Families Choose Faith-Based Recovery

The addiction crisis in Eau Claire has reached alarming levels, prompting families to seek alternatives to traditional secular treatment approaches. Recent data reveals the urgent need for effective intervention:

  • Between 2018 and 2024, Eau Claire County lost 125 residents to drug overdoses, with 87 of those deaths related to opioids
  • In 2023 alone, 14 opioid overdose deaths were recorded in the county
  • In 2024, there were 187 hospitalizations and 93 ambulance runs for opioid-related overdoses in Eau Claire County (population ~108,000)
  • Fentanyl-related overdoses have become the leading cause of death for Wisconsin residents aged 25 to 54
  • Approximately 26% of Eau Claire County residents engage in excessive drinking, exceeding both state and national averages
  • Among high school students who have consumed alcohol, 34% engage in excessive drinking
  • Wisconsin youth aged 12-17 show concerning rates: 7.5% currently use drugs, 6.5% used marijuana in the past month, and 11.2% have misused prescription pain medications

Why Distance is Your Greatest Asset in Addiction Treatment

Many Eau Claire families initially view the 699-mile distance to our Tennessee facility as a barrier, but this geographic separation actually provides crucial advantages for lasting recovery. Distance from familiar environments and triggers creates the space needed for genuine transformation.

The benefits of seeking treatment away from home include:

  • Escape from Triggers: Familiar environments can reinforce substance use. Being away from home removes these triggers, helping the individual form new, healthier habits.
  • Privacy and Anonymity: Receiving treatment outside your local community protects patients from judgment and stigma. It allows deeper therapy by fostering vulnerability and emotional safety.
  • Greater Focus and Immersion: Non-local treatment creates a distraction-free space for recovery, helping patients concentrate fully on healing and personal growth.
  • Access to Specialized Care: Local options can be limited. Traveling for care opens the door to specialized therapies and programs that better match individual needs.
  • Prevents Premature Exit: Physical distance adds a layer of accountability. The effort required to leave treatment often gives patients time to pause, reflect, and stay committed.
  • Psychological Commitment: Traveling for treatment marks a clear break from past habits, reinforcing a commitment to meaningful change and long-term recovery.
  • Healthier Family Dynamics: Temporary space from family allows both the individual and their loved ones to work on issues separately, setting the stage for healthier boundaries and stronger relationships later on.

Breaking Free from Local Triggers and Enabling

Geographic separation from Eau Claire eliminates immediate access to dealers, drinking buddies, and codependent relationships that often sabotage recovery efforts. The familiar bars, neighborhoods, and social circles that enabled addictive behaviors lose their power when your loved one is focused on healing in a Christ-centered environment.

This distance also protects family members from enabling behaviors that may have developed over time. Both the individual in treatment and their family can work on establishing healthier patterns without the daily pressures and triggers that perpetuate addiction cycles.
